Support comments on FOREIGN DATA WRAPPER and SERVER objects.

This mostly involves making it work with the objectaddress.c framework,
which does most of the heavy lifting.  In that vein, change
GetForeignDataWrapperOidByName to get_foreign_data_wrapper_oid and
GetForeignServerOidByName to get_foreign_server_oid, to match the
pattern we use for other object types.

Robert Haas and Shigeru Hanada

/*
* get_foreign_data_wrapper_oid - given a FDW name, look up the OID
*
* If missing_ok is false, throw an error if name not found. If true, just
* return InvalidOid.
*/
Oid
get_foreign_data_wrapper_oid(const char *fdwname, bool missing_ok)
{
Oid oid;
oid = GetSysCacheOid1(FOREIGNDATAWRAPPERNAME, CStringGetDatum(fdwname));
if (!OidIsValid(oid) && !missing_ok)
ereport(ERROR,
(errcode(ERRCODE_UNDEFINED_OBJECT),
errmsg("foreign-data wrapper \"%s\" does not exist",
fdwname)));
return oid;
}
/*
* get_foreign_server_oid - given a FDW name, look up the OID
*
* If missing_ok is false, throw an error if name not found. If true, just
* return InvalidOid.
*/
Oid
get_foreign_server_oid(const char *servername, bool missing_ok)
{
Oid oid;
oid = GetSysCacheOid1(FOREIGNSERVERNAME, CStringGetDatum(servername));
if (!OidIsValid(oid) && !missing_ok)
ereport(ERROR,
(errcode(ERRCODE_UNDEFINED_OBJECT),
errmsg("server \"%s\" does not exist", servername)));
return oid;
}
